LG first to tap Intel's 'Moorestown' chip for smartphone

The Intel architecture is coming to smartphones.

LG Electronics and Intel are announcing a collaboration based on Intel's Moorestown silicon and the Linux Moblin v2.0 software platform at the Mobile World Congress in Barcelona on Monday. The future LG device--which is being described as a smartphone--is expected to be one of the first Moorestown designs to market.

Moorestown is the code name for the successor to Intel's current Atom processor.

Toshiba handheld hits 1GHz with 'Snapdragon'

Has the era of the 1GHz smartphone arrived? It has for Toshiba, which has tapped Qualcomm's new Snapdragon silicon.

The Toshiba TG01 Windows Mobile phone was unveiled Tuesday, according to reports. Based on Windows Mobile 6.1, it is designed to take on the iPhone 3G.

Only 9.9mm thick, it uses a 4.1-inch WVGA 800 x 480 384k pixel resistive touch screen and comes with support for 3G HSPA, Wi-Fi, GPS and assisted-GPS.

Qualcomm picks up AMD's graphics assets

This was originally posted at ZDNet's Between the Lines.

Qualcomm on Tuesday said it has acquired "certain graphics and multimedia technology assets" from Advanced Micro Devices' handheld business.

The acquisition was only for $65 million, so we're not talking a huge deal, but what used to constitute AMD's handheld business is off the chipmaker's books, as it focuses on its core PC and graphics semiconductor markets.

Qualcomm grabs AMD handheld, graphics tech

Qualcomm has picked up handheld assets from Advanced Micro Devices, including graphics chip technology.

San Diego, Calif.-based Qualcomm and Sunnyvale, Calif.-based AMD announced on Tuesday that Qualcomm has acquired graphics and multimedia technology assets, intellectual property and resources that were "formerly the basis of AMD's handheld business."

The acquisition includes "graphics cores that we have been licensing for several years," said Steve Mollenkopf, executive vice president of Qualcomm and president of Qualcomm CDMA Technologies, in a statement.

Intel, Nvidia bookend top-20 chip ranking

iSuppli releases its preliminary 2008 top-20 chip rankings as semiconductor suppliers fall upon hard times.

Intel, Samsung, Texas Instruments, Toshiba, and STMicroelectronics occupy the top five positions, while Advanced Micro Devices was No. 11 and Nvidia No. 20 in the ranking.

Memory chip manufacturers are some of the hardest hit. South Korea-based Hynix, which dropped from No. 6 to No. 9, and Micron Technology (No. 16) are both restructuring. Micron is reducing staff and shutting down facilities, while Hynix seeks outside investors.

Qualcomm designs low-cost PC alternative

Mobile chipmaker Qualcomm has developed a new, low-cost computing platform that it hopes will provide an alternative to Windows-based PCs in parts of the world where traditional broadband connections aren't available.

The new platform called Kayak will be based on Qualcomm's dual-core MSM7 series chipsets. Eventually, the design could also include Qualcomm's Snapdragon chipsets, which offer both GSM-based and CDMA-based 3G technologies.
